New in Version 2.1
Digital Image Processing 2.1 adds a GUIKit-based package for
interactively selecting regions of interest in an image for possible
measurement or modification. Several functions have been added to
simplify selecting subregions of an image, picking control points, and
obtaining intensity profiles. With a mouse, users can now select
regions by using any of the Mathematica 2D graphics
primitives. New functionality includes:
- Six new functions for interactive region-of-interest selection
- CircleSelectGUI
- DiskSelectGUI
- LineSelectGUI
- PointSelectGUI
- PolygonSelectGUI
- RectangleSelectGUI
- Three new graphical extensions to existing functions
- ImageTakeGUI
- ImageWarpGUI
- LineProfileGUI

Modified in Version 2.0
The following functions have been modified in ways that may
affect/break code based on Version 1:
- BlockProcessing--optional
last argument dropped
- EdgeMagnitude--option
GradientType
-> None may be used to return a list of directional edge
images; option NonMaxSuppress
added to permit suppression of false edge responses
- FromChannels--option
ColorFunction
added; all
inputs must now be grayscale images
- ImageData--range
of supported color spaces extended to
include CIE spaces XYZ, L*a*b*, and L*u*v*, and an unspecified color space
(with option setting ColorFunction
-> None)
- ImageRotate--option
FullImageView
added;
implementation significantly faster for interpolation of orders 0, 1,
and 3
- ImageWarp--implementation
for interpolation of orders 0,
1, and 3 modified for speed
- LaplacianFilter--filter
can now be of any desired dimension
- OptimumThreshold--input
argument must be a histogram (in
Version 1 it was an image); new methods added
- RegionPoints--Circle
and Disk
added to list of supported Graphics
primitives
- ToChannels--function
modified to return list of
single-channel grayscale images
- WarpMatrix--formulation
for general geometric
transformation modified; resulting matrix has dimensions different
from Version 1

General Features
- Support for grayscale, RGB, HSV, and CMYK color models
- Extensive collection of point and area operators
- Image measurement functions
- Intensity profiles over arbitrary polygonal paths
- Histograms and co-occurrence matrices
- Fast integer-factor interpolation and decimation functions
- Resizing, padding, and merging
- Spatial transformations including rotation and arbitrary-order warping
- Area-of-interest processing over arbitrary polygonal regions
- Dozens of predefined filters and morphologic operators
- Support of a comprehensive number of filter design algorithms
- Fourier, cosine, Hadamard, and wavelet image transforms
